Busta Rhymes Taps Kendrick Lamar for “Look Over Your Shoulder”
Lamar’s first feature of 2020 arrives on this single from ‘Extinction Level Event 2: The Wrath of God.’
Kendrick Lamar joins up with Busta Rhymes for a verse on “Look Over Your Shoulder,” which will appear on Rhymes’s upcoming album Extinction Level Event 2: The Wrath of God, dropping tomorrow, October 30. The track, which also samples Jackson 5’s “I’ll Be There,” makes Kendrick’s first album feature of the year.
This album will also be a return of sorts for Busta himself; his most recent album up to this point, The Return of the Dragon (The Abstract Went on Vacation), released in 2016. But Extinction Level Event 2: The Wrath of God is already set to make quite the splash with appearances from Chris Rock, Ol’ Dirty Bastard, Mariah Carey, and Anderson .Paak.
And the tail end of 2020 looks to be heating up for Kendrick. The rapper recently sparked rumors that his highly-anticipated fourth album could be on the way following the announcement of an exclusive global deal with Universal Music Publishing Group.
